What Techno Electric & Engineering Company does

Techno Electric & Engineering is a power-infrastructure EPC company specializing in transmission and distribution — substations (including 765 kV and GIS), switchyards and grid works for utilities and state discoms — plus smart metering projects under India's RDSS program. It has divested most legacy wind generation assets and is investing in a new growth leg building data centres. Revenue is led by the EPC order book tied to grid capex, with an asset-light, cash-rich balance sheet.

It is among India's leading substation EPC specialists.
